Transaction 5f115251c90bc4cb5bf131d6a228575595e5c04df81e2e1d519568c43a7a3117
1 Input
1 Output
-
5f115251c90bc4cb5bf131d6a228575595e5c04df81e2e1d519568c43a7a3117:0
- value
- 744848
- script pubkey
- OP_0 OP_PUSHBYTES_20 ebb97b73888a602354b24efd768c2b6c9de62258
- address
- bc1qawuhkuug3fszx49jfm7hdrptdjw7vgjcwd3tzf